Republican Sen. Tommy Tuberville filed paperwork Monday to officially enter the 2026 race for Alabama governor, saying he wants to be the “chief recruiter to make our state better.”
Tuberville, who leveraged fame from his Auburn University football coaching days to win election to the U.S. Senate in 2020, announced last year that he planned to run for governor instead of seeking another Senate term. He signed paperwork at the Alabama Republican Party headquarters on Monday to officially enter the race.
“It’s time to come home, put together a staff and worry about the state of Alabama and the people here. People deserve a better state every day that they live here,” Tuberville said after filing the campaign paperwork…
